Object theft in Germany concerns many citizens and causes worried faces. Current incidents show that the crime situation should not be underestimated. Local media reported on a particularly brazen incident in Marpingen, in which a quartet robbed vending machines. Loud WNDN The perpetrators showed no inhibitions between the machines and the police emergency vehicles. The police speak of alarming audacity and are now investigating the four young men who formed a group.

But what does this mean for the general crime situation in Germany? Statistics from Statista show that crime includes all kinds of crimes. In 2022, around 5.63 million crimes were recorded, with theft and robbery crimes being the order of the day. What is particularly striking is that there were over 1.78 million thefts recorded by the police in the same year - a significant increase compared to previous years. Theft and robbery on the rise

Theft is the taking of someone else's property, while robbery refers to violent theft. North Rhine-Westphalia remains a hotspot, with worrying numbers such as over 23,500 residential burglaries in 2022, representing more than 35% of all cases in the federal states. These statistics make it clear: crime is not just an abstract problem, but rather affects the quality of life in our cities.

On average, over 38,000 police-recorded robbery crimes were recorded in 2022, including 1,060 handbag snatches and 628 gas station robberies. While the clearance rate for robbery crimes is almost 60% - higher than for residential burglaries - these figures show that prevention is urgently needed. The look into the future

The BKA's 2024 police crime statistics, which are referenced in BKA, show that overall crime will increase slightly in 2024 fell by 1.7% to 5,837,445 registered crimes. However, this decline contrasts with rising violent crime, which has reached its highest level since 2007. The number of suspected children and young people has also increased, which raises questions about the causes and social responsibility.

The numbers indicate that an effort across society is necessary to sustainably reduce crime. Preventive measures are particularly needed in urban areas, where theft and robbery are very common.
